The size of Collie is approximately 53.4 square kilometres. There are 25 parks, covering nearly 43.6% of the total area. The population of Collie in 2016 was 7587 people. By 2021 the population was 7599 showing a population growth of 0.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Collie is 60-69 years. Households in Collie are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Collie work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 75.40% of the homes in Collie were owner-occupied compared with 71.80% in 2016.
